Output f33e5296056f04fbc3fc02a4d3ea79cd38ed8239e21cc45409435e741ea8e12e:1

value
6968326653145
script pubkey
OP_0 OP_PUSHBYTES_20 de2153ba394abeb6243a00887fc3b2c1ba5a3c8a
address
tb1qmcs48w3ef2ltvfp6qzy8lsajcxa950y2tdhfvr
transaction
f33e5296056f04fbc3fc02a4d3ea79cd38ed8239e21cc45409435e741ea8e12e
confirmations
173748
spent
true